A Tale of Two Elements: Store Name vs. Store Domain

At the core of your Shopify store's identity are two critical elements: the store name and the store domain (URL). The store name is what appears on your website, in marketing materials, and the essence of your brand identity visible to your customers. Meanwhile, the store domain, or URL, is the web address customers use to find your online sanctuary. Initially, Shopify assigns a default domain incorporating .myshopify.com, but customizing it can significantly enhance your brand's professionalism and memorability.

Embarking on a Name Change Journey

There are several compelling reasons to consider changing your Shopify store name:

  1. Rebranding or Brand Overhauls: A shift in business direction or an evolution in your product offerings might necessitate a more suitable name.
  2. Expanding Your Business: Outgrowing your initial niche may require a name that encapsulates your broader range of products or services.
  3. Acquiring Another Store: Taking over an existing store often means wanting to infuse your unique identity into the brand.
  4. Clarifying a Misleading Name: Sometimes, your initial choice might not convey the intended message or might be too similar to another entity, leading to confusion.

How to Change Your Shopify Store Name & Domain: A Step-by-Step Guide

Changing your store name involves a simple process accessible through your Shopify admin dashboard, specifically within the Settings > Store Details section. However, updating your domain name, especially to a custom one, involves a few more steps but is crucial for maintaining consistency between your store name and the web address.

Keeping SEO in Sharp Focus

A significant concern with changing your store name or domain is its impact on your store's search engine optimization (SEO). Incorrectly managing this transition can temporarily affect your visibility in search results. However, by carefully planning and implementing SEO best practices such as setting up 301 redirects, updating all external links pointing to your old domain, and communicating with your customers about the change, you can minimize or even neutralize potential negative impacts.

FAQ Section

Q1: Is it complicated to change my Shopify store name? A: Changing your store name is quite straightforward through the Shopify admin dashboard under Settings > Store Details.

Q2: Will changing my store domain affect my SEO? A: Yes, but this impact can be managed effectively with proper SEO strategies, including implementing 301 redirects to guide visitors from the old to the new domain.

Q3: How many times can I change my Shopify store name? A: You can change your store name as needed, but frequent changes are not recommended due to potential customer confusion and impacts on branding.
